Transaction 734106b8f6e19717ddc100f5dbc754ac7236b21309206de0fb88e595523975e0

1 Input
1 Outputs
  • 734106b8f6e19717ddc100f5dbc754ac7236b21309206de0fb88e595523975e0:0
  • value  101459
    address  16V2AADd6uLCevutbvm1GnFinAiBJsB3Wh